Don’t You Pucking Dare is a dark hockey romance that can be read as a standalone. It contains themes that may be triggering to some, please check the TW list inside of the book.

An "accident". A man crippled. A brother's promise. What one must do to get payback leads to a dark, twisted plan to take everything.
Lola is a scholarship recipient who's mother is hospitalized and never knew her father. She becomes a pawn in a game of vengeance. Unbeknownst to her, hockey player and Reaper pledge, Brody, has his sights set on her for his plan to take down her father.
Stalking, spying, and teasing, Brody slowly drags Lola into a game they both want to win. He makes his move, believing he'll break her. However, Lola turns the tables and goes after him.
As they both play this dangerous game, outside forces twist and pull them around, using them both for their own amusement.
If you like your romance on the dark side, these two twisted lovers have a story to tell.
